Output 642f184c60d233c20695c8d3b247654e03bf38dd9c7d2e1084b6bda0e627446c:0

value
1199334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0afce92148727e40186be39264cf172afb9d3e0c OP_EQUAL
address
32h7f18aBPf833UNM6pVxoe9jpq5fjuhsT
transaction
642f184c60d233c20695c8d3b247654e03bf38dd9c7d2e1084b6bda0e627446c
spent
true